**Lecture Overview** Towards decarbonization by 2050, this year marks the issuance of various government policies, including the 7th Basic Energy Plan, and discussions on institutional design based on a series of evaluations of electricity system reforms have begun, indicating that the environment surrounding the electric utility industry is undergoing a transformation into a new era. In this context, the electric safety industry, which has supported user safety for nearly 60 years, currently faces its biggest challenge: a shortage of personnel. In response, cross-industry efforts have been made to raise awareness and promote entry into the field. Additionally, initiatives aimed at securing talent and creating rewarding jobs and workplaces are also underway. This lecture will detail the rapidly changing business environment, the reality of personnel issues and past efforts, the organizational culture that needs improvement directly related to personnel issues, and the challenges of creating an organizational culture where individuals can take voluntary and autonomous safe and correct actions. **Lecture Topics** - Changes in the situation surrounding the power system - The electric utility industry transformed by power system reforms - Electric safety business and personnel issues - Creating an organizational culture that enables voluntary and autonomous safe and correct actions - A mid-term management plan aimed at returning to the basics and pursuing growth and development - Related Q&A - Business card and information exchange meeting
